If you remember the Speranza Watchlist, you’ll welcome the discovery of Speranza Bounties, a fan-made ARC Raiders site that hosts a leaderboard of elimination. It’s a simple thing: people join the site, vote for who they want to have the biggest bounty, and whoever eliminates them in ARC Raiders gets points.
Players can list their targets based on their in-game behavior, and as you can imagine, some of the most prolific streamers in the world have found a place on the hitlist.
Is Speranza Bounties Legit?
Speranza Bounties isn’t a ‘legit’ site, as it’s just a bit of fun assembled by fans of Embark Studios’ extraction adventure title, ARC Raiders.
It looks pretty polished, though. The concept has been around since at least November 2025, so it’s not a brand-new thing, but it’s gaining traction now because of the recent discourse around ‘streamers ruining games‘ like ARC Raiders.
There’s a leaderboard for the players with the most confirmed kills, a shop that leans on Printful’s ready-made service to supply avid gamers with merchandise, and special, weekly bounties that offer more points.
Users can filter targets by platform and region to find and eliminate the most wanted users in the game, and, of course, most of those users are the biggest streamers in the extraction shooter space.
The top of the table is reserved for TheBurntPeanut, who has been voted for 658 times (at the time of writing). He has been labelled with three key ‘reasons’ for his placement on the list:
- Voice Chat Snake
- Vault Vulture
- Hate Speech
Behind TheBurntPeanut sits Nadeshot, and as you work your way down the list, you’ll be able to see many more streamers and content creators:
- Cloakzy
- Nickmercs
- Tfue
- Tylerno1
- summit1g
- Gotaga
Many regular players also take up a spot on the list, and judging from the volume of some votes against them, they must be doing something wrong in the game.
